Wayne Rooney exposed Leeds United with one brutal line

At the start of the season, Leeds were getting praised for their fighting qualities. However, as the season has worn on, the flaws in the squad are becoming too big to hide.

The defence is cracking up, and while the midfielder has remained the best aspect of their team, it is failing to cover the gaps left at both ends of the pitch.

Wayne Rooney, during his appearance on the Stick to Football podcast, brutally exposed the biggest problem of the current Leeds team this season with just one line.

He said, “They have been struggling to score.”

Roy Keane and Ian Wright were discussing whether Leeds would score on Sunday, but Rooney jibed in and made it clear what he feels.

Former defender Gary Neville also insisted that he never felt comfortable about Leeds’ chances this season and admitted that they were shocking against Everton on the first day of the season, despite winning the game.

“I said Leeds were going down after watching them in the first game of the season, even though they beat Everton”, he said.

“I thought it was not right that.

“They were so shocking.”

Hard to argue against Rooney

Only Wolves have scored fewer goals than Leeds, and Joe Rodon, a defender, is leading the scoring charts for the Whites in the Premier League this season.

Leeds are not creating enough chances, and their strikers are not clinical enough to convert those chances inside the penalty box.

The Whites needed to add real quality to their forward line last season. However, ended with Lukas Nmecha and Dominic Calvert-Lewin on free transfers.

They are now paying the price of not spending enough money on strikers while splurging cash on back-up defenders such as James Justin and Sebastiaan Bornauw.
